1. Influencer Legal Risks:

As influencers build their online presence and engage with brands and followers, they encounter various legal risks, including copyright infringement, contract disputes, and regulatory compliance issues. Having legal guidance is crucial for mitigating these risks and safeguarding their interests.

2. Navigating Complex Contracts:

Influencers often collaborate with brands and agencies through contractual agreements. These contracts may include terms related to content creation, sponsorship deals, and intellectual property rights. An influencer attorney can review and negotiate these contracts to ensure favorable terms and protect the influencer’s rights.

What Protections are in Place for Influencers in the USA?

1. FTC Guidelines:

The Federal Trade Commission (FTC) in the USA enforces regulations related to influencer marketing and disclosure. Influencers are required to disclose any material connections with brands or advertisers, including sponsored content and affiliate partnerships. Compliance with FTC guidelines is essential to avoid legal repercussions.

2. Intellectual Property Rights:

Influencers create original content, including videos, photos, and written posts, which may be protected by intellectual property laws. Copyright and trademark protections safeguard influencers’ creative works and brand identities, allowing them to enforce their rights against unauthorized use or infringement.
